Ticket #88: Badge system migration, night-shift notice. Over the weekend, Fenwick Row is moving from the old Keystone readers to the new Ardale panels. Night staff should expect the lift lobby readers to be offline between 01:00 and 04:00 on Saturday. During this window, use the stairwell doors only, and log every entry in the paper register at the guard desk. Legacy badges will stop working once the cutover completes. Until your replacement badge arrives, the night crew should use the interim code below.

door code, yageg-yagap: bdg-DNN-9

Hi all — the Lattice Weaver cut-over finished last night. The dependency graph visualizer now reads from the new edge store, and the old crawler is retired. New folks: you don't need the legacy setup docs anymore. To get a local instance rendering graphs, start your config with these values.

settings of hagug-yawip:
druix:
  pin: 0136
  metrics_host: metrics.druix.qorvellabs.internal
  tenant: kelox
  seal: seal_71ff4acd

Handover — prototype run. Two Fennik R3 prototype boards, anti-static cases, shelf C in the secure cage. Going to the Oakbarrow test lab, needed there by Wednesday. Paperwork is the blue folder taped to the top case; keep it with the shipment. No substitutions on the courier — booked vetted service only. Cage key returned to me after load-out. Hand-over instruction for the courier is below.

handover note for kajop-yawep: the ulair jorox courier leaves the belax ledger at gate 9133 under passcode 401596

# Break-Glass: Catalog Cache Invalidation

Scope: the Pinrow product catalog at Veldstone Retail. If stale prices persist after a purge and the Hollowmere invalidation queue is wedged, use break-glass to flush the edge tier directly. Contractors: get verbal sign-off from the catalog lead first. Steps: open the Hollowmere admin shell, select emergency-flush, confirm the tenant, and run it once — repeated flushes thrash the origin. Access is logged and expires after 20 minutes. Unseal the admin shell with the passphrase below.

recovery phrase for kahop-tajog: istix-casvan